George Calderon : Kessinger Publishing : 9781164089780 : 1164089781 : 10 Sep 2010 : George Calderon: A Sketch From Memory is a biography written by Percy Lubbock in 1921 about his friend George Calderon. Calderon was a British writer, playwright, and translator who was killed in action during World War I. Lubbock's book is a personal and intimate account of Calderon's life and work, drawing on their friendship and shared experiences. The book covers Calderon's childhood, education, and early career as a writer, as well as his involvement in the literary and theatrical circles of his time. Lubbock also delves into Calderon's personal relationships, including his marriage to actress Edith Craig. The book concludes with a moving account of Calderon's death in battle and the impact it had on those who knew him.
